Customer Service Representative II

The Customer Service Representative II serves as the first point of contact for visitors and callers, providing friendly, professional, and efficient front-line support. This role is responsible for assisting walk-in customers at the front desk, answering phone calls, managing email correspondence, and directing inquiries to the appropriate departments or individuals. In addition to general customer service duties, this position oversees the production of campus ID cards, the issuance of Metro U-Passes and parking permits. This position works closely with other departments within University Services such as Parking & Transportation, Dining & Business Services and Card Access on the Danforth campus. The ideal candidate is approachable, detail-oriented, and able to manage multiple tasks while maintaining a high level of customer satisfaction. Position requires the ability to work flexible shifts. Some weekends may be required.
